Job Description

The Finance & Strategy team is responsible for improving strategic and financial decision-making across the company. We maintain the company’s operating model, analyze deals and capital allocation decisions, and think a lot about strategy.

Our team’s core value is trust – we build it by making what is complex simple, and we do it with elegant models that are both accurate and easy-to-understand. Business partners appreciate our insight and trust us to help them solve difficult problems. At Square we believe that good ideas can come from anywhere, and we’ll trust you to collaborate with others, form intelligent opinions, and present your thoughts to decision-makers and the executive team.

We’re looking for a finance manager who will work as a member of Square’s Finance & Strategy team supporting our UK business and New Markets initiatives. You will play an integral part in Square’s success by providing strategic decision support, forecasting, and financial planning & reporting. This position will be based in Dublin, Ireland.

You will:

  • Act as a Finance Business Partner for our UK and New Market teams
  • Support strategic decision making, which will include analytics initiatives such as financial modeling, go-to-market strategy formulation, pricing, LTV analysis, channel performance measurement and partnership negotiations
  • Own top-line forecasting and resource budgeting for new markets
  • Support the financial reporting needs for tax and regulatory purposes
  • Actively mine data from our Structured Query Language (SQL) databases and use it to predict short-term and long-term trends for forecasting and making strategic decisions
  • Partner with Business team through lifecycle of merchant acquisition strategies by quantifying success metrics, securing company resources and analyzing program returns
  • Analyze deal terms with strategic partners, advise on in-process negotiations, and propose creative solutions to reach a goal or maximize an outcome
  • Liaise with US International Accounting team on transactional and financial close matters to ensure accuracy over financial statement reporting
  • Assist business partners to adhere to policies, procedures and resolution of ad hoc business issues
  • Assist in developing and maintaining a robust internal control environment for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X) compliance
